Website Services Firm to Relocate 500 Jobs & Headquarters to Allen, TX
12/09/2011
PFSweb offers e-commerce solutions for renowned brands that dominate almost every major industry in the world.
CEO Mark Layton said the expansion will nearly double its North Texas call center footprint and provide the company with room to grow, according to the newspaper article. The location also offers better proximity to PFSweb's workforce.
"Business growth has primarily been the reason behind relocating the Plano [Dallas] call center operations downtown," Layton has said. "We will create 600 to 800 new jobs over the next several years to support that business growth."
